Output 939aa58fbbbe6fc7f6fe86369af7886c48374a2a39d766a33ef449430099f6e4:0

value
18538
script pubkey
OP_0 OP_PUSHBYTES_20 8a9d8b765f788291bbcbef04bfa41609e5a645b5
address
bc1q32wckajl0zpfrw7tauztlfqkp8j6v3d4c5h05l
transaction
939aa58fbbbe6fc7f6fe86369af7886c48374a2a39d766a33ef449430099f6e4
spent
true